3 Trends Set to Shape Oil and Gas This Year

After posting record profits in 2022, oil and gas companies say they’re preparing to ramp up investments in clean energy and new technology this year. Exxon Mobil Corp. has said it will spend about $3.4 billion annually on alternative energy over the next five years, about 15 percent more than its plans last year. Only Two Units at Tarbela Power Plant Operating

mid a power shortage crisis already engulfing the country, 15 production units of the Tarbela power plant have been shut down – its administration attributing the problem to a reduction in water release from the dam because of the canal cleaning campaign. Only two units of the power station are generating 340 MW of electricity. The problem at Tarbela has aggravated the already precarious power situation in the country.Tarbela Dam is a major source of hydropower generation in the country with an installed capacity of 4,888 MW.
